BIBRA LAKE SPEEDWAY 1982
*********************************************************************************************************************************
1982 - AUSTRALIAN FORMULA 500 CHAMPIONSHIPThe Perth tq Car Club hosted the Australian Formula 500 championship on the 10th and 11th of April 1982 at there Bibra Lake venue.
An unknown on the national scene Victorian racer by the name of Max Dumnesney went on to take out the event from another west Australian in Des Ferris, followed by Peter Sumpton and in forth Johnny Anderson.
The West Australian run title was hailed a complete success by all concerned.
The very next weekend the same group of racers competed in the Australian Short track championship, which was held at the West Arthur Motor Sports Accociation home track at Darkan.
Darkan Speedway was chosen because of it layout including Ess bends in an uphill straight.
